Spanlight streams chunks rather than loading files into memory. Chunks are hashed client-side; only hash mismatches trigger content transfer. No file content is persisted server-side — diffs render from ephemeral buffers cleared after session end. Access requires repo-level read permission; there is no anonymous mode. Audit events log file paths and byte ranges, never content. Sandboxing details, including the seccomp profile for the chunker process, are documented on the internal review page.

runbook for tafof-yawif: https://confluence.tolvaqsys.internal/display/display/browse/pages/7be3

TURN-208: Gatevale turnstile counters at the Merrow Field pilot double-count when a rotation reverses mid-cycle. Attendance totals drift roughly 2% high per event. The debounce window fix is implemented, reviewed by Ilsa, and soak-tested across two simulated match days without drift. Ready for your cut; the candidate build is identified below.

trace token, tagag-tafog: htk6_5ed18c

Subject: On-call handover — export memory spikes

Handing over the open issue on the Tallyform spreadsheet export service. Memory usage climbs sharply on exports over roughly 40k rows because the renderer buffers the full workbook before streaming. I've capped concurrent exports at three as a stopgap and added an alert at 80% heap. The real fix is the chunked writer branch, which is mid-review. Watch the Friday batch exports closely. If anything regresses, loop in the export service owner at the address below.

alerts address for bawif-hahig: norwyn_gorys_lamath@olvarqlabs.test

CI note: Parcelhawk webhook suite flaking on main. Cause: the mock courier endpoint returns before the signature middleware warms up; first delivery event 401s. Workaround: rerun the job once, or set WEBHOOK_WARMUP=3s in the pipeline env. Permanent fix tracked for next sprint. Confirm you're on the affected build using the token below.

session token of tajef-bageg = htk21_5d90d574934f3ccae6437